Output 21bb9a901e7e2b453bf9308125d72a097a51653a31ab44f80fb9c83deddd28eb:3

value
615547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a54a84f2cffda7a919e4cff630e450038ffa5698 OP_EQUAL
address
3GkzgtYrAHfUN7uhKQNzu4kx1H9o3YFe1p
transaction
21bb9a901e7e2b453bf9308125d72a097a51653a31ab44f80fb9c83deddd28eb
confirmations
162082
spent
true